The AIF Project

Elvin SAVAGE

Regimental number6107
Place of birthLondon, England
SchoolSt John's Church of England School, Guernsey, England
Age on arrival in Australia26
ReligionChurch of England
OccupationElectrical assembler
Address141 Arundel Street, Forest Lodge, New South Wales
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ation27
Height5' 4"
Weight128 lbs
Next of kinMother, Mrs R Savage, 40 Plato Road Acre Lane, Brixton London, England
Previous military serviceNil
Enlistment date4 March 1916
Date of enlistment from Nominal Roll24 February 1916
Place of enlistmentSydney, New South Wales
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name13th Battalion, 19th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/30/4
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Sydney, New South Wales, on board HMAT A18 Wiltshire on 22 August 1916
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ll13th Battalion
Other details from Roll of Honour CircularHe always had a desire to go to Australia and although he experienced some hardships, after the first few months of his adventure in Australia, he became much attached to the place and many of the people he came to be associated with.
FateDied of disease 8 February 1918
Place of death or woundingDied in Hospital, London, England
Date of death8 February 1919
Age at death35
Age at death from cemetery records30
Place of burialBrookwood Military Cemetery (Plot IV, Row F, Grave No. 4), Surrey, England, England
Panel number, Roll of Honour,
  Australian War Memorial
70
Miscellaneous information from
  cemetery records
Son of Rebecca SAVAGE, 361 Coldharbour Lane, Brixton, London, England
Other details

Died in London, England, before return to Australia.

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
